DISCUSSION The City has made a significant investment in rehabilitating arterial streets over the last ten years and, therefore, maintaining and protecting that investment is a top priority. The City's Pavement Management Program effectively strategizes short and long -term maintenance schedules to maximize performance of the entire street pavement network, including identifying preventative maintenance improvement projects. The application of a surface slurry seal to asphalt streets every seven to ten years ensures a continued high level of service. Historically, a conventional slurry seal has been used. In contrast, rubberized slurry seals offer superior performance over conventional slurry by providing a more flexible surface that resists cracking, while also benefiting the environment by repurposing recycled tires. There are several rubberized slurry products available, including tire rubber modified slurry seal (TRMSS) and rubberized emulsion aggregate slurry (REAS). Both of these products are industry proven applications for street maintenance. Additionally, both provide similar wear and aesthetic characteristics. Based on the City's Pavement Management Program, staff has identified a project area in which the TRMSS product will be used to rehabilitate arterial streets (Exhibit 1). Contract Award for Arterial Streets Resurfacing Using Tire Rubber Modified Slurry August 5, 2014 Page 2 To determine future preference, the performance of this product will be compared with another project area using the REAS product.
